Got this stuff outta there this am, when I hit the 52 q, it was 5" deep and pinged like old glory at 88 on the TID...too high for a normal Q, and too low for a half, so I was not sure what I had until I stabbed it and got a finger on it down in the dirt, once you tip the coin sideways down in the hole, and get it between your finger and screwdriver, you can feel the smooth silver and know right away before you see it! It looks pretty fresh, nice reeding and little wear. I was running the F70 with the 11"dd at 75 sens, -3 thresh, DE mode, DP tones, 1 disc, 1 notch. I am sure even a lower sens would have got it, as hard as it was pinging...I was really there hunting for a gold mens class ring that I figure is there, to try to keep up with some of you guys in the gold department, lots of zinc stabbin on account of that specific target signature... 60 coins, 3.51 into the pot.
